9th grade student caught solving paper in car
LAHORE:Punjab Minister for Education, Rana Sikandar Hayat, visited various examination centres on Raiwind Road to inspect the ongoing 9th-grade examinations and overall arrangements.
During the inspection, acting on a tip-off, the minister caught a student red-handed while cheating at Government Boys High School, Ali Raza Abad. According to the minster's PRO, the student was found solving his paper while seated in a car on the examination centre premises. Investigations revealed that the centre’s staff and principal were actively involved in facilitating the cheating. The minister disclosed that the candidate was the son of PSO to the owner of a private housing society, and that the vehicle would regularly enter the centre to assist him in solving paper through unfair means.
Following the incident, the minister ordered the immediate arrest and removal of the entire centre staff, including the principal. An FIR was registered. He directed departmental action under the PEEDA Act and ordered the dismissal of those involved. In recognition of the teacher who provided the tip-off, Rana Sikandar Hayat announced a reward of four basic salary bonuses and a certificate of appreciation. The minister reiterated a policy of zero-tolerance against cheating mafias, stating that no student will be allowed to unfairly deprive others of their right, regardless of their background or influence.
